    What Is Tort Law?

    Personal injury claims, property damage, and privacy rights are filed under Tort Law. However, it is also important to realize that Tort Laws vary, according to the state issued. 

    What Is Personal Injury?

    A personal injury might be due to a physical or emotional trauma and are part of Tort Law. It is also interesting to note that Tort Law falls into 3 distinct areas.

    1. Intentional Torts – Battery
    2. Unintentional Torts – Negligence
    3. Strict Liability – Product Liability

    Understanding California Tort Law

    California Tort Law differs from some federal laws and other state laws. For example, government agencies are not subject to Tort Laws. However, the California Tort Claims Act does allow individual to bring claims against a government agency, if the claim is filed within a specified time frame. However, the Medical Injury Compensation Reform Act places a limit on the amount that the claimant can collect for damages.

    Reckless Misconduct/Comparative Negligence

    California includes a third liability instead of the usual two offered by other states. This third liability is Reckless Misconduct or the willful neglect of the rights of others. In addition, California set in place a comparative negligence law, which allows a claimant to collect, even if they were partly responsible for injuries.
